Subject: Password reset revamp shipping in Quillgate 4.2

Team,

The revamped reset flow replaces the old token table with signed, single-use links that expire after fifteen minutes. Future maintainers should note: the legacy endpoint stays live for two releases behind a feature flag, and the audit log now records every issuance and redemption separately. Please read the migration notes before touching the mailer templates, as the variables changed. The staging build that passed full verification is identified below.

pipeline stamp: htk31_f769b577b3028a4e9958e5bb8d1259a

Welcome aboard! Quick provenance notes for the Dustpan sweeper, our data-retention job. Every sweeper build is produced by the Foundry pipeline at Kettleworth, signed, and recorded in the provenance ledger — no hand-rolled binaries, ever. Before you deploy anything, check that the artifact you're holding matches a ledger entry; mismatches go straight to the on-call. The token identifying the current blessed build is listed below.

session token of tajep-fawep = htk14_3691488dd7a1d3

## Changelog — Pickforge 2.8: default changes

For the eng sync: the pick-list optimizer now defaults to zone-batched routing instead of single-order serpentine paths. Benchmarks at the Dunmoor test warehouse showed 18% shorter walk distance. Batch size and aisle-congestion weighting are now tunable; previous hardcoded values are gone. Sites wanting old behavior must override explicitly. The new shipped defaults are below.

deployment values, bahof-badug:
[rusix]
team = zorok
access_code = ac_641cbe
owner = ulair.tamius
host = rusix.torvasoft.local
port = 5672
peer = ulaix.sivrelworks.internal
salt = 1df570ed
pin = 6327

Subject: Trailview audit-log viewer cut-over complete

Hello plugin authors,

The migration of the Trailview audit-log viewer to the Kestrelgate backend finished last night. All read paths now go through the new query layer; legacy endpoints return deprecation warnings until the next release. Please verify that your plugins handle paginated responses correctly, as page sizes have changed. Retention and filtering behavior are otherwise unchanged. For reference, the production settings the viewer now runs with are as follows.

service settings:
[casax]
port = 6379
team = rusir
host = casax.zemvarhq.corp
region = outer-4
access_code = ac_9808ce
timeout_ms = 1500